Managing payroll in the UK is complex, with strict compliance requirements set by HMRC. Businesses must submit Real Time Information (RTI), calculate PAYE, manage National Insurance contributions, and comply with statutory pension auto-enrolment. Mistakes can lead to fines, reputational damage, or additional administrative burdens.

How QuickBooks Payroll Works

QuickBooks Payroll automates payroll processes with minimal manual input. Businesses enter employee information, salary details, and benefits, and the system calculates pay, taxes, and contributions in compliance with UK law.

Core mechanics include:

  • Employee setup: Add staff, tax codes, NI numbers, and bank details;
  • Pay runs: Weekly, monthly, or custom schedules;
  • Deductions & contributions: Automatic calculation of taxes and pension contributions;
  • Reporting: RTI submission, payslips, and statutory forms.

The cloud-based model allows employers and accountants to access payroll information securely from anywhere, ensuring continuity and remote work compatibility.

Warnings & Considerations

While QuickBooks Payroll is user-friendly, there are some limitations:

  • Best suited for businesses already using QuickBooks; standalone use may be less intuitive;
  • Limited advanced payroll features for large multi-entity companies;
  • Some users report setup complexity for initial employee data import;
  • Customer support quality may vary based on subscription level.
